OK here is an idea I have had for last 2 years since the new santos-dumont releases with lacquer finish. Thinking of a special WPS edition, cartier comes to mind because they have made special editions for different sites/watch groups. This would be the 30k range watch.



From revolution watch.com

I think polished platinum is so beautiful, it becomes so vibrant and shiny. My only hangup is that it often gets marred or scuffed easily. So here is my idea - a polished platinum santos-dumont (like the green one as an example), but no colored lacquer, but CLEAR lacquer. This would allow the finish to remain very vibrant. It would still be a dress watch, not hardened for sport or anything, but in the casual wearing with wool sweater or starched shirts, etc it hopefully would not get marred.

1) CASE - santos-dumont specification, polished platinum with clear lacquer coating.

Now the dial, I have had many thoughts here. First is just to take the rose gold guilloche dial from the S-D xl limited edition 2021. I like the inner guilloche, the applied numerals and sword hands. Can pick a color for hands and numerals. Either plated WG or blued. Another idea is to adapt the new tank American dial released on 2024....

if we wanted to get really special, try to go with something like this stone lapis lazuli dial with applied WG numerals and hands 🀀

2) DIAL- dreaming - lapis lazuli. More realistic use the S-D XL from 2021 or the 2024 release tank americane




From monochrome-watches.com





From mrwatchley.com





From fratellowatches.com




3) I prefer applied breguet or stylized numerals, although on the tank style dial I like the Roman's πŸ€·β€β™‚οΈ. Hands I like sword style matching the numerals. Maybe even an evacuated sword style like the pasha?

4) carbochan - generally red for platinum , may not go with dial color? If lapis dial would be ridiculous to have lapis in crown. Or diamond? Or standard red.

5) limitation - I think special case back with individual numbering. With closed case could have design or message? Maybe initials and limitation number. In a dream scenario if there were 12 editions, have each edition number with an off color Arabic on the dial to indicate the edition πŸ‘Œ

Now, say they can't do the polished platinum with clear lacquer. Maybe a vertical brushed platinum case and bezel santos-dumont, with the tank American style dial above. That would be sharp. Edit- I should add, for strap either maroon red or blue for lapis lazuli dial. Would be fun to have maybe alligator and a nubuck. Plt pin buckle.

No bad ideas here...

But... There is a lot of risk here, the business side is complex. The delivery side is complex as well, are they all delivered from one boutique at one location at a centralized event? Who services the customer? The local boutique or authorized dealer? Etc. I'd also say the pricing is a little on the high side - here on WPS, the reality is that we are a group that has a readership amongst the more high end collectors, but we want to encourage knowledge hungry and technically inclined younger col

It's not quite as simple as you assume...

Presell? WPS would have to commit to a set number by the manufacture before we have a concept shown. And we can't pre-sell without a concept - unless you think you'd give WPS 30K of your money carte blanche! Thus, no risk is minimized. Sadly, things aren't as simple as you initially assumed. Not sure what you mean by your last sentence; Cartier doing unique pieces and 3-4 edition sets for themselves is one ting, does not necessarily mean they'll do it for someone else.
